Also, I have a 5 speed Auto-Stick in my Nitro and you DON'T have to put it in 'N' to get the trasmission out of 'Auto-Stick' mode and into 'Drive.' So, either for some strange reason that system works differently in vans, or this guy is a huge retard. All you have to do is hold the gearshift at the '+' side of the gate, and in a little more than 1 second(!) the transmission changes to 'Drive' on it's own. No neutral involved.
